site stats

Different types of recursion

WebFeb 20, 2024 · A function is called direct recursive if it calls itself in its function body repeatedly. To better understand this definition, look at the structure of a direct recursive … WebWhat are the different types of Recursion in C? 1. Primitive Recursion. It is the types of recursion that can be converted into a loop. We have already seen the... 2. Tail …

function - Powershell Recursion with Return - Stack Overflow

Webrecursive - This can only resolve two heads using 3-way merge algorithm. When there are more than one common ancestors that can be used for 3-way merge, it creates a merged tree of the common ancestors and uses that as the reference tree for the 3-way merge. ... merge-ort: add handling for different types of files at same path. Signed-off-by ... WebA function that calls itself is said to be recursive, and the technique of employing a recursive function is called recursion. It may seem peculiar for a function to call itself, … nepa overview presentation https://noagendaphotography.com

Different Types of Recursion in Golang - GeeksforGeeks

WebJul 10, 2024 · Recursion is a concept where a function calls itself by direct or indirect means. Each call to the recursive function is a smaller version so that it converges at … WebJan 16, 2024 · Recursion can be a bit of a headache. For those trying to get to grips with the concept of recursion, I often feel it can be beneficial to first realise that recursion is more than just a programmatic practise — it … nepa oral surgery forty fort pa

Different Types of Recursion in Golang - GeeksforGeeks

Category:Recursion in Data Structure: How Does it Work, Types & When Used

Tags:Different types of recursion

Different types of recursion

Recursion vs. Looping in Python - Medium

WebThe method of call leads to different types of recursion. Recursion is a problem-solving technique that contains some special properties. In the process of recursion, the … WebOct 5, 2024 · 1. It is quite reasonable to fold over the elements of a tree in the same way as List.fold_left, eg, let rec foldl f acc = function Leaf -> acc Branch (x, l, r) -> foldl f (f …

Different types of recursion

Did you know?

WebThe function Count() below uses recursion to count from any number between 1 and 9, to the number 10. For example , Count(1) would return 2,3,4,5,6,7,8,9,10. 21. What are the two types of recursion? Recursion are mainly of two types depending on whether a function calls itself from within itself or more than one function call one another mutually. WebAug 28, 2013 · However, when the recursion unwinds (one function call is done and the program goes back to the last one) it gets interesting. Now, the value of N immediately resets to what it was when the call that just got unwound was made. This is fortunate because this function relies on that behavior. However, the vals [] array behaves …

WebMay 6, 2011 · Here is a table to represent different types of run time recursive algorithm. Similarly, here is a table to represent different types of compile time recursive algorithm. These types of recursive algorithms are very specific to C++, because not every language supports compile-time recursion or template meta programming. WebWe've partnered with Dartmouth college professors Tom Cormen and Devin Balkcom to teach introductory computer science algorithms, including searching, sorting, recursion, and graph theory. Learn with a combination of articles, visualizations, quizzes, and …

WebJun 6, 2024 · Examples of different kinds of recursion will be given below. The relation "x1 precedes x2" (where $ \overline{x}\; _ {1} , \overline{x}\; _ {2} $ belong to the domain of the sought function) in various types of recursion ( "recursive schemes" ) may have a different sense. ... The partial types of recursion referred to have precise mathematical ... WebJun 27, 2024 · Types of Recursions 1. Direct Recursion: These can be further categorized into four types: Tail Recursion: If a recursive …

WebMar 16, 2024 · Types of recursion Direct Recursion. Tes types of recursion occur when a function calls itself directly to accomplish a task. This type of... Indirect or Mutual …

WebIn this dissertation, it is shown that declarative, feature-based, unification grammars can be used for efficiently both parsing and generation. It is also shown that radically different algorithms are not needed for these two modes of processing. Given this similarity between parsing and generation, it will be easier to maintain consistency between input and … its july 4thWebJul 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. its js collectionWebApr 10, 2024 · types of algorithms can be categorized into different types based on their purpose, design, and complexity. Here is an overview of the most common categories of types of algorithms: ... Recursive Algorithms. Recursive algorithms are a type of algorithm used to solve problems by breaking them down into smaller subproblems and solving … nepa non profits